Laura Ashley Opening times In Dumfries, UK

All stores Laura Ashley in Dumfries: 1

Time in United Kingdom: 09:23:59

Laura Ashley Dumfries, Dumfries

Unit 5 Cuckoo Bridge Retail Park, Glasgow Road

Open now, until 18:00